引言
HTML5作为现代网页设计的基石,自从推出以来就受到了广泛关注。它不仅带来了丰富的功能,还让网页设计变得更加灵活和高效。对于初学者来说,HTML5的学习之路可能充满挑战,但只要掌握正确的方法,你也可以轻松上手,成为网页设计高手。本文将为你提供一份详细的HTML5入门攻略,带你一步步走进这个充满创意的世界。
第一部分:HTML5基础
1.1 HTML5简介
HTML5是HTML的第五个版本,它在原有HTML的基础上进行了大量改进,增加了许多新特性和功能。HTML5让网页设计更加丰富,交互性更强,而且对移动设备的支持也更加出色。
1.2 HTML5文档结构
一个标准的HTML5文档通常包含以下结构:
<!DOCTYPE html>:声明文档类型<html>:根元素<head>:包含元数据,如标题、字符集等<body>:包含网页内容
1.3 常用HTML5标签
<header>:表示页面或区块的页眉<nav>:表示导航链接<article>:表示文章内容<section>:表示页面中的一个内容区块<aside>:表示页面内容的一部分,与主内容相关,但可以独立
第二部分:HTML5高级特性
2.1 表单元素
HTML5引入了许多新的表单元素,如<input type="email">、<input type="date">等,这些元素提供了更好的用户体验和浏览器验证。
2.2 媒体元素
HTML5支持内联视频和音频,使用<video>和<audio>标签可以轻松嵌入多媒体内容。
2.3 Canvas和SVG
Canvas提供了绘图能力,而SVG则是一种基于可扩展矢量图形的图像格式。它们都是HTML5的强大功能,可以用于创建复杂的图形和动画。
第三部分:实战演练
3.1 创建一个简单的网页
以下是一个简单的HTML5网页示例:
<!DOCTYPE html>
<html>
<head>
<title>我的第一个HTML5网页</title>
</head>
<body>
<header>
<h1>欢迎来到我的网页</h1>
</header>
<nav>
<ul>
<li><a href="#home">首页</a></li>
<li><a href="#about">关于我</a></li>
</ul>
</nav>
<article>
<h2>关于我</h2>
<p>这里是我的个人介绍...</p>
</article>
<footer>
<p>版权所有 © 2023</p>
</footer>
</body>
</html>
3.2 使用CSS进行样式设计
为了使网页更具吸引力,你可以使用CSS来设计网页的样式。以下是一个简单的CSS样式示例:
body {
font-family: Arial, sans-serif;
}
header, footer {
background-color: #f1f1f1;
padding: 10px;
text-align: center;
}
nav ul {
list-style-type: none;
padding: 0;
}
nav ul li {
display: inline;
margin-right: 10px;
}
第四部分:进阶学习
4.1 学习JavaScript
JavaScript是网页设计的灵魂,它可以让你的网页具有交互性。学习JavaScript可以帮助你实现更复杂的网页功能。
4.2 使用框架和库
有许多优秀的框架和库可以帮助你更高效地开发网页,如Bootstrap、jQuery等。
结语
通过以上攻略,相信你已经对HTML5有了初步的了解。只要不断实践和学习,你将能够掌握HTML5的精髓,成为一名优秀的网页设计高手。记住,学习是一个持续的过程,保持好奇心和热情,你将走得更远。祝你在网页设计的世界里自由翱翔!
